										<content:encoded><![CDATA[<h1>Pellet boiler FOCUS monoblock - can be installed even in the corridor</h1>
<p>Monoblock pellet boilers are distinguished, first of all, by their convenient form factor. This means that private homeowners can buy a boiler without having to redo the heating system and without organizing a separate boiler room. An ordinary utility room is suitable for installing the boiler. In some cases, it can even be a corridor, since we offer a FOCUS monoblock pellet boiler that has a very presentable appearance and a body made of polished stainless steel, and is also protected from excessive heating using basalt wool.</p>
<p>In other words, if you place it even in a living space, it will not lead to injuries, burns or other troubles. Unlike potbelly stoves, in which you can constantly add firewood, pellet boilers need to be loaded with pellets about once a week.</p>
<h2>Let&#039;s note the advantages</h2>
<p>When we talk about autonomous environmentally friendly heating, as a rule, our consumers think that we will talk about heat pumps, solar panels and other similar technologies. In fact, TM FOCUS offers a real solid fuel boiler, but one that runs on “clean” pellet granules. Moreover, the FOCUS monoblock pellet boiler, unlike similar foreign versions, can operate on high-ash pellet granules without violating EU environmental safety requirements.</p>
<p>The smoke coming from your home will be white and almost cold, since the ash residues are completely burned thanks to the special design of the combustion chamber, and the heat exchangers remove the generated heat as much as possible. We can say that well-designed pellet boilers are the most economical and demonstrate the highest efficiency, over 95%, in terms of heat removal from the fuel and the heated coolant. And in many respects, the FOCUS monoblock pellet boiler is the best model on the Ukrainian market precisely in terms of technical solutions. The monoblock design and aesthetic design of the housing only complement the technically advanced performance.</p>
<p>So, about the benefits for households:</p>
<ul>
<li>ideal for single-circuit heating systems, and by connecting such a boiler to the heating system of private home owners, the problem with coolant circulation in the system disappears, since the pump is built into a monoblock;</li>
<li>weather regulation of combustion in combination with automatic switching on means complete automation of heating with complete independence from external networks. All you need is to make the settings and load the pellet in time;</li>
<li>aesthetic appearance of the boiler in a monoblock format - if necessary, the boiler can be placed in a technical room or corridor without making a separate boiler room, as is required when purchasing other FOCUS equipment.</li>
</ul>
<h2>What are the disadvantages compared to a gas boiler?</h2>
<p>The proposed FOCUS monoblock pellet boiler in its functionality resembles a single-circuit boiler, which can be adjusted to three modes: operation with hot water supply, water heating and heated floors. The equipment is not two- or three-circuit, as many owners of private houses are used to, using gas heating and a modern gas boiler. The monoblock is designed for heating either one heating circuit, or hot water supply, or for heated floors.</p>
<p>Technically, you can connect it to a heat accumulator and distribute it to other heating circuits, but this can be done through the built-in DHW circuit, and not through the water heating mode.</p>]]></content:encoded>

										<content:encoded><![CDATA[<p>Increasingly, the word “energy saving” is heard on the Ukrainian market, but what content it carries, we usually evaluate based on emotions, and do not pay attention to numbers. But if we take a separate segment of equipment - energy-efficient pumps that we use in furnaces and figure out in detail where there is &quot;energy saving&quot; and scale it within our mother Ukraine, then the numbers will be more than impressive.</p>
<h2>Legal Requirements</h2>
<p>Another aspect that should be paid attention to, today is the compliance of projects with current legislation. At the moment there are several documents in force that already require the use of energy-efficient pumps with a wet rotor, as an alternative to all of us the usual 3-speed ones, namely the latest revision of the DBN and <a href="https://zakon.rada.gov.ua/laws/show/153-2019-%D0%BF#Text" rel="nofollow noopener" target="_blank">&quot;Technical regulations regarding the requirements for ecodesign of self-contained circulation pumps and sealless compasses integrated into the device&quot;</a>, according to which from September 2022. 3-speed pumps are not officially marketed and wet rotor pumps must meet an EEI (Energy Efficiency Index) ≤ 0.2. In this article, we will not go into the study of legislation and regulatory documents, but consider the practical effect of using energy efficient pumps and try to understand whether this makes sense.</p>
<h2>As an example, I took one of the projects, the input data:</h2>
<p><strong>Object type:</strong> car wash.</p>
<p><strong>Location: </strong>Zaporizhzhia.</p>
<p><strong>Boiler type to be installed:</strong> Focus 100 kW.</p>
<p><strong>Necessary operating parameters of the pumps according to the project:</strong></p>
<ul>
<li><strong>Boiler circuit:</strong> Q = 5.47 m3 / h, H = 5.29m.</li>
<li><strong>Heating circuit:</strong> Q = 3.0m3 / h, H = 6.0m.</li>
<li><strong>Ventilation unit contour:</strong> Q = 2.8 m3 / h, H = 4.0 m.</li>
<li><strong>Recirculation circuit:</strong> Q = 0.5 m3 / h, H = 0.8m.</li>
</ul>
<p><strong>Consider two options for the boiler room configuration:</strong></p>
<ul>
<li>1) Using 3-speed pumps.</li>
<li>2) When using energy efficient pumps.</li>
</ul>
<p>The qualities of a pump supplier, consider the company IMP PUMPS doo.It is a company from Slovenia that has been specializing in the production of pumps for heating and water supply systems for more than 75 years and has a wide product line.</p>
<h3>We make a selection according to the first option:</h3>
<ul>
<li>boiler circuit: Q=5.47 m3/h, H=5.29m - GHN 32/120-180 (3rd speed, P=265 W)</li>
<li>heating circuit: Q=3.0 m3/h, H=6.0m - GHN 32/80-180 (3rd speed, P=210 W)</li>
<li>ventilation unit circuit: Q=2.8 m3/h, H=4.0m GHN 32/80-180 (2nd speed, P=160 W)</li>
<li>recirculation circuit: Q=0.5 m3/h, H=0.8m - SAN 15/40-130 (1st speed, P=40 W)</li>
</ul>
<p><strong>The total installed power for this variant is: 675.00 W.</strong></p>
<h3>We make a selection according to option number 2:</h3>
<ul>
<li>boiler circuit: Q=5.47 m3/h, H=5.29m - NMT SMART 32/80-180 (3rd speed, P=150 W)</li>
<li>heating circuit: Q=3.0 m3/h, H=6.0m - NMT MINI 32/100-180 (3rd speed, P=90 W)</li>
<li>ventilation unit circuit: Q=2.8 m3/h, H=4.0m NMT SMART 32/40-180 (2nd speed, P=70 W)</li>
<li>recirculation circuit: Q=0.5 m3/h, H=0.8m - SAN ECO PRO 15/15 B (1st speed, P=9 W)</li>
</ul>
<p><strong>The total installed power for the second option is: 319.00 W.</strong></p>
<p><strong>The difference between the first and second options is: 356 watts.</strong></p>
<p>The average duration of the heated season in Zaporozhye is 157 days.</p>
<p>The average electricity tariff for commercial consumers is 4.5 UAH. for 1kW * h</p>
<p>Let&#039;s calculate the average annual potential savings when using energy efficient pumps:</p>
<p><strong>Savings: 0.356 kW * 24 h * 157 days = 1341.408 kW * h</strong></p>
<h2>Payback</h2>
<p><strong>In monetary terms, the savings will be: 1341.408 kW*h*4.5 UAH. =6036.33 UAH for 1 heating season.</strong></p>
<p>Investment when using 3-speed pumps is: 1115.96 euros.</p>
<p>The investment for energy efficient pumps is € 1,696.57.</p>
<p>The difference in the amount of investment is 580.61 euros.</p>
<p>The course today is: UAH 30.38. for 1 euro.</p>
<p><strong>Let&#039;s calculate the payback period: 580.61 euros * 30.38 UAH / 6036.33 UAH = 2.92 heating season.</strong></p>
<p>We see that the payback period when using energy efficient pumps is quite fast, in 3 seasons we will fully return the investment and begin to get the effect.</p>
<p>This is, of course, an approximate calculation, and in each particular case, the payback period may vary, this calculation is made only with the aim of making such big words as &quot;Energy saving and energy efficiency&quot; more visible.</p>
<p><strong>This calculation also does not take into account the additional benefits of energy efficient pumps:</strong></p>
<ul>
<li>potential for additional energy savings due to automatic modulation of operating parameters depending on the load;</li>
<li>the presence of a large number of protections for difference from 3-speed pumps;</li>
<li>some models are already equipped with thermal insulation, which increases the efficiency of your system;</li>
<li>reduction in battery capacity or generator power to ensure uninterrupted operation of the heating system;</li>
<li>an increase in electricity tariffs.</li>
</ul>

										<content:encoded><![CDATA[<h1 dir="auto" style="text-align: left;">To use or not to use the buffer tank with the pellet boiler?</h1>
<p dir="auto" style="text-align: left; font-size: 110%;"><strong>Today we will analyze the technical question, should I use a buffer tank with a pellet boiler? In general, the installation of a solid fuel boiler without a program-controlled <a href="https://firebox.com.ua/en/product-category/pelletnye-gorelki-focus/">pellet burner</a> and without a buffer tank, it is extremely dangerous and not economically viable, since in the smoldering mode the efficiency of a hard top drops rapidly, especially for boilers with afterburning of combustion products, which in theory should be more efficient than conventional ones.</strong></p>
<blockquote>
<p dir="auto" style="text-align: left;"><strong><a href="https://firebox.com.ua/en/product-category/tverdotoplivnye-pelletnye-kotly/">Pellet boiler</a> controlled by a microcontroller, so the use of a buffer capacity is technically impractical. But why? And why is an automatic boiler often cheaper than a well-made manual boiler?</strong></p>
</blockquote>
<h2>A few words about solid fuel boilers</h2>
<p>As we wrote earlier - everything <a href="https://firebox.com.ua/en/product-category/piroliznye-tverdotoplivnye-kotly-focus/">solid fuel boilers</a> (TT-boilers) to achieve maximum efficiency operate in a narrow range of temperatures and capacities. The range width for different types of TT boilers varies, but all the same, the main drawback is the narrow zone of stable operation. This problem is almost invincible and is the main problem of solid fuel heating.</p>
<p>The second and essential problem arising from the first is security. The stacking of fuel in various types of combustion (upper, lower, long-term, pyrolysis and the like) has a common drawback - the fuel cannot be extinguished quickly. The masonry warms up, pyrolysis gas (thermal decomposition gas) is released, which burns to generate heat. For some solid fuel boilers, the gas burns up, for some it burns down, which does not significantly affect the controllability of the process.</p>
<p>In the event of a power outage or if the heating system is unable to extract all the heat released from the fuel filling, the boiler temperature inevitably begins to rise. The options for solving this situation are varied, but they all boil down to a simple idea - this is heat loss. And, as the most cost-effective way, the most optimal way is to dump heat into the battery or buffer tank (depending on the tasks). It is the volume of this container that is a kind of - a guarantee of safety, and not efficiency, which allows you to reset excess temperature.</p>
<h2>What about objections?</h2>
<h3>Closing the blower</h3>
<p>Even completely closed air blowing into the boiler does not extinguish the fuel and heat continues to be released. If in domestic boilers and furnaces this process has a controlled destructive effect, then in industrial and semi-industrial versions everything is much more complicated.</p>
<blockquote><p>It is precisely because of the safety and economic component in the disposal of excess heat that buffer and heat storage tanks have become widespread.</p></blockquote>
<p>Moreover, a conflict arises - the TT boiler works optimally in hot mode, when the supply is in the range of 75-85 * C, the return is at least 65 * C. At the same time, a small margin is the most efficient in terms of efficiency, when there is very little left before the boiling zone of the coolant. At this moment, the fuel burns most efficiently, but the flue gas temperatures also increase (the efficiency decreases with emissions to the street).</p>
<p>Excess heat, as we have already written, is safely discharged into a heat accumulator. With the closing of the air intake, the situation can be aggravated by the fact that a lot of unburned carbon appears in the furnace, which is precisely the basis of tar and tar on the walls of the boiler and chimney. With enough of it, the chimney can flare up, which can lead to a fire, destruction of the chimney structure, and other negative consequences. That is, extinguishing the boiler in this way is not recommended and even dangerous under a certain set of circumstances.</p>
<h3>Objections backed by history</h3>
<blockquote>
<p style="text-align: left;"><strong>There are a lot of craftsmen among the people who are trying to prove that boilers without a buffer tank are not dangerous, they can be successfully operated, they give a lot of examples. But the regulatory framework and the rules for the operation of solid fuel boilers - work without a buffer tank is strictly prohibited. This is labor protection, written in the lives of people, and engineering calculations and economic justifications.</strong></p>
</blockquote>
<p><a href="https://firebox.com.ua/wp-content/uploads/2022/11/pozhar-v-dymohode.jpg"><img decoding="async" class="aligncenter wp-image-6247 size-full" src="https://firebox.com.ua/wp-content/uploads/2022/11/pozhar-v-dymohode.jpg" alt="Should a buffer tank be used with a pellet boiler?" width="960" height="540" title="Should I use a buffer tank with a pellet boiler? - FireBox - Solid fuel pellet boilers, pellet burners, industrial" srcset="https://firebox.com.ua/wp-content/uploads/2022/11/pozhar-v-dymohode.jpg 960w, https://firebox.com.ua/wp-content/uploads/2022/11/pozhar-v-dymohode-510x287.jpg 510w, https://firebox.com.ua/wp-content/uploads/2022/11/pozhar-v-dymohode-300x169.jpg 300w, https://firebox.com.ua/wp-content/uploads/2022/11/pozhar-v-dymohode-768x432.jpg 768w, https://firebox.com.ua/wp-content/uploads/2022/11/pozhar-v-dymohode-18x10.jpg 18w" sizes="(max-width: 960px) 100vw, 960px" /></a></p>
<h2>So should you use a buffer tank with a pellet boiler?</h2>
<p>We are often as producers<a href="https://firebox.com.ua/en/product-category/tverdotoplivnye-pelletnye-kotly/"> pellet boilers</a> we encounter the opposite opinion when the standards of the classical norms of TT boilers are applied to the pellet boiler. Namely, this is the need to install at least a buffer tank and a heat accumulator. This misconception often pushes people to additional costs for no apparent reason. A pellet boiler with a burner is controlled by a microcontroller, which provides instant extinguishing of the boiler or a reduction in the intensity of combustion.</p>
<blockquote><p>The bottom line is simple - for the normal operation of a pellet boiler or a pellet burner installed in a TT boiler, the installation of additional heat accumulators or buffer tanks is not required, unless otherwise provided by the project and the needs of the heating system.</p></blockquote>
<p>For example, in greenhouse complexes, to compensate for a sharp drop in temperature, it is simply vital to install a capacious heat accumulator, but this is not necessary for <a href="https://firebox.com.ua/en/product-category/pelletnye-gorelki-focus/">pellet burner.</a> In addition, the buffer tank is installed as a secondary heating boiler for domestic hot water, but again this does not apply to technical requirements.</p>
<h3>Hydraulic connections with buffer tank and indirect heating boiler</h3>
<figure id="attachment_8013" aria-describedby="caption-attachment-8013" style="width: 661px" class="wp-caption aligncenter"><a href="https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-s-teplovym-buferom-i-goryachim-vodosnabzheniem.png"><img loading="lazy" decoding="async" class="size-full wp-image-8013" src="https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-s-teplovym-buferom-i-goryachim-vodosnabzheniem.png" alt="Connection diagram with thermal buffer and hot water supply" width="661" height="327" title="Should I use a buffer tank with a pellet boiler? - FireBox - Solid fuel pellet boilers, pellet burners, industrial" srcset="https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-s-teplovym-buferom-i-goryachim-vodosnabzheniem.png 661w, https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-s-teplovym-buferom-i-goryachim-vodosnabzheniem-510x252.png 510w, https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-s-teplovym-buferom-i-goryachim-vodosnabzheniem-300x148.png 300w, https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-s-teplovym-buferom-i-goryachim-vodosnabzheniem-18x9.png 18w" sizes="auto, (max-width: 661px) 100vw, 661px" /></a><figcaption id="caption-attachment-8013" class="wp-caption-text">Elementary connection diagram with a heat buffer and climate control of a pellet boiler</figcaption></figure>
<p>&nbsp;</p>
<figure id="attachment_8010" aria-describedby="caption-attachment-8010" style="width: 512px" class="wp-caption aligncenter"><a href="https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-klimat-kontrolya-s-rasshiritelnymi-modulyami-i-teplovym-buferom.jpg"><img loading="lazy" decoding="async" class="wp-image-8010 size-full" src="https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-klimat-kontrolya-s-rasshiritelnymi-modulyami-i-teplovym-buferom.jpg" alt="Connection diagram for climate control with expansion modules and thermal buffer" width="512" height="288" title="Should I use a buffer tank with a pellet boiler? - FireBox - Solid fuel pellet boilers, pellet burners, industrial" srcset="https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-klimat-kontrolya-s-rasshiritelnymi-modulyami-i-teplovym-buferom.jpg 512w, https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-klimat-kontrolya-s-rasshiritelnymi-modulyami-i-teplovym-buferom-510x287.jpg 510w, https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-klimat-kontrolya-s-rasshiritelnymi-modulyami-i-teplovym-buferom-300x169.jpg 300w, https://firebox.com.ua/wp-content/uploads/2024/02/shema-podklyucheniya-klimat-kontrolya-s-rasshiritelnymi-modulyami-i-teplovym-buferom-18x10.jpg 18w" sizes="auto, (max-width: 512px) 100vw, 512px" /></a><figcaption id="caption-attachment-8010" class="wp-caption-text">Hydraulic isolation for connecting several heating circuits (2 floors or two houses) with hot water supply, radiator circuits and heated floors. Controlled by PLUM automation</figcaption></figure>
<p><a href="/en/primery-gidravlicheskih-shem-obvyazki-kotlov-focus-oborudovannnyh-pelletnymi-gorelkami/">Examples of hydraulic decoupling when installing pellet boilers</a></p>
<h3>Examples</h3>
<p>Let&#039;s take a simple example. A household boiler weighs an average of 200-300 kg. When the power supply is turned off, there is approximately 300-500 grams of fuel in the pellet burner nozzle (let&#039;s take it with a margin of 50 kW), which, under ideal circumstances, can produce a maximum of 2.5 kW of heat. This energy is enough to heat a mass of 300 kg from 85*C to 92*C (i.e. only 7*C).</p>
<p>Approximate calculation does not take into account the loss of heat with flue gases, reduced combustion intensity in the absence of intensive fan blowing, and in any case, microcirculation present in the system. All these factors will narrow the already small delta of stable operation. That is, we see that even in the most difficult case, the situation cannot get out of control. At the same time, the automation of the pellet burner has a number of additional protection systems against overheating of the boiler, and we also take into account the mandatory presence of relief valves.</p>
<blockquote><p>All these factors and the exact dosage of fuel with modern automation equate the flexibility of a pellet boiler, its automation, and the response to a change in the heating system to a gas boiler, which itself does not require a buffer tank.</p></blockquote>
<p>From this it follows that in a pellet boiler room there is no need for most devices inherent in a manual loading boiler room!</p>

<h1 dir="auto">To install or not to install a buffer tank when installing a solid fuel boiler</h1>
<h4 dir="auto" style="text-align: left;">The use of a conventional &quot;hardtop&quot; without <a href="https://firebox.com.ua/en/product-category/pelletnye-gorelki-focus/">pellet burner</a> and without a buffer, it is extremely dangerous and economically unprofitable, since in the smoldering mode, the efficiency of a solid fuel rapidly drops, and this is especially true for boilers with afterburning of combustion products!</h4>
<h2>Consider the features of &quot;solid tops&quot;</h2>
<h4 dir="auto"><strong>Everything <a href="https://firebox.com.ua/en/product-category/tverdotoplivnye-kotly-dlya-gorelok/">solid fuel boilers</a>, regardless of their type and method of fuel combustion, have the following common features:</strong></h4>
<ol>
<li dir="auto">They work only in a narrow high-temperature schedule (90/75 0С or 80/600С).</li>
<li dir="auto">They can change the power in the range 100…50% by reducing the amount of incoming air during combustion. Moreover, with a decrease in power, the efficiency drops sharply due to an increase in the proportion of CO.</li>
<li dir="auto">The boiler cannot be stopped until all the fuel in it has burned out.</li>
<li dir="auto">A manually loaded boiler is selected with a power reserve of at least 30% for the coldest five-day period for residential premises and up to 50% for office buildings, since a significant problem with the quality and humidity of the fuel may arise, which must be taken into account.</li>
</ol>
<div dir="auto">Modern heating systems, depending on the outside temperature and indoor climate, change the flow and temperature in the heating devices. Thus, when installing a solid fuel boiler in a heating system, a dilemma arises: the boiler works most economically in high-temperature mode, and the heating system in low-temperature mode.</div>
<div dir="auto">Buffer capacity solves this dilemma. It allows the solid fuel boiler to burn fuel with maximum efficiency and store it in a buffer tank with little loss. And the heating system takes away the accumulated heat in clearly calculated portions according to its need and depending on the heat loss of the building.</div>
<div dir="auto">It was also noticed that systems with solid fuel boilers that do not have a buffer capacity have a fuel consumption 2-2.5 times higher than systems with a buffer capacity. This is due to the fact that most of the time during the heating season the weather is relatively warm, which means that the boiler is constantly operating with a lack of combustion air, and more than half of the fuel literally flies into the pipe in the form of CO (undercooking).</div>
<blockquote><p>Highest efficiency in <a href="https://firebox.com.ua/en/product-category/piroliznye-tverdotoplivnye-kotly-focus/">solid fuel boiler</a> at the moment when it is above the return dew point (usually 51 degrees), but has not yet reached the set temperature set on the controller! As soon as the solid fuel boiler reaches the set temperature and goes into smoldering, the boiler efficiency drops down to 20%, thereby offsetting all the savings.</p></blockquote>
<div dir="auto">In addition to saving fuel, the buffer tank allows you to significantly reduce the number of fuel loadings during the day. The estimated volume of the tank depends on the boiler power, fuel load and burning time per load and what you want from the buffer tank (accumulation of unused energy). It is recommended from a minimum of 25 liters (this volume is usually set to protect against boiling and cannot properly accumulate energy in sufficient volume) to <strong>optimal 55 liters per kW of boiler power.</strong></div>
<div dir="auto">
<blockquote><p>And as a result, we get a pellet automatic boiler house much cheaper than a boiler house with manual fuel loading, no matter how paradoxical it sounds, both in the cost of equipment and in the price of fuel, which is usually lower than the cost of labor of stokers!</p></blockquote>
